31 minutes ago, Mason__666 said:

Remind me? Not played since 360. TIA

I don't remember completely how I did it I'd have to look up a what I sent a friend awhile back but you can set it up where there's nearly no cool down on the shotguns using the exploding ammo so you can spam it on saren and have the meat mods for the shotgun so it's doing massive damage per explosion and do this with your whole party 

 

So basically you and your team kill sarens Shield in afew shots then you can rag doll him till the cut scene then kill his shield and ragdoll him around the map till he's dead combine this with the shield from Shepard's job class(I forget which has it) and your basically on his mode taking no damage except sniper fire and just bounce saren around like popcorn in a popcorn maker it takes like 3 minutes if that on insanity

 

https://www.playstationtrophies.org/forum/topic/172009-saren-on-insanity-the-lolway/

 

That thread describes the basic method I used not just original post but also the second one about using dambeners and coils. And I never needed to use throw I just used the shotguns and had my party aim for what I did 

 

Using this way is likely the easiest if your doing the glitch cause you probably don't want to do the fight the hard way 3 times back to back

 

Also there's the glitch that let's u play casual make a save before the fight complete the game start on insanity get to a certain point then save and load up that end game save switch to insanity and only need to do the final boss

25 minutes ago, the1andonly654 said:

So this doesn't work on patched digital version? Are there any other workarounds (aside from downgrading the digital version) or with digital I have to do all games either on insanity from the start or 2 playthroughs each? 

I love the games but I've played them twice on pc, then platinumed the trilogy on PS3. So I'd rather just breeze through them for the story/100% if possible. 

 

The glitch for Insanity in ME 1 works on the latest patch (1.03). The glitch that allows you to finish ME1 three times and get Insanity II and Insanity III only works up to 1.02.

 

Since saves are compatible between versions, the most convenient way is probably to just finish the trilogy on 1.03, keeping in mind to make an additional save between the final boss fight in ME1. Then, after finishing everything else, you can downgrade to 1.00 and get your three missing Insanity trophies.
